Daily Archives: December 5, 2008

‘Star Trek’ Boldly Going IMAX

Not long ago it was rumored that when J.J. Abrams’ Star Trek hits theaters this May 8, it will do so by arriving in both conventional theaters and on IMAX screens. While nothing official has been announced yet, it appears [...]

Animallball D&D Monster Tourney

What’s the best D&D monster? Is it the powerful beholder that makes players quake with fear? Or is it the clever goblin that proves so versatile in every campaign? There’s no definition for what’s “best”– that’s something only you can [...]